    How To Stop a Scan In Progress?

    Hello friends, I have installed the Norton Anti Virus 2011 on Windows 7 Professional. The NAV 2011 starts a background scan every now and then, on no permanent schedule that I can decide. Okay, very well with me, although irregularly the scan starts at a non convenient time. When this occurs, I am unable to find a technique to stop the scan. Is there a technique to stop a scan in progress? If not, then is there a technique to schedule the scans (day and time)? If I can't do whichever of these, I'll have to turn off automatic scans and manually run scans on my own schedule. please help me to stop a scan in progress.

    Re: How To Stop a Scan In Progress?

    The inactive rapid scans occur while here is an antivirus update. They are extremely rapid and light on the machine, so you shouldn't observe them. The inactive Full System Scan will occur roughly around every 7 days from the time when you had set-up the program. It will start to run while your computer system is inactive and will discontinue when we start to use your machine. It will stay restarting until it stops the scan, restarting where it was episodic. If you would moderately plan your weekly antivirus scans, you can do that as well you would punch scan now, custom scans, subsequent to complete system scans, strike schedule and you can set up your plan for that. Though, the inactive rapid scans will keep on run. This was found in the Norton Help Files.

    Re: How To Stop a Scan In Progress?

    You can't cancel it, only pause it and then as soon as your system is idle for the set amount of time it will start again, and again, and again. The full automatic scan runs once a week at pretty close to the exact time and if it's triggered to run when your normally using your system it will continue to bother you every time. Also be alert that the disk optimizations and Norton insight can run background tasks if you use them.

    Re: How To Stop a Scan In Progress?

    In reality when you try to schedule a complete system scan NIS will mechanically inquire you if you want to immobilize the IDLE complete scan. Also, even when an inactive complete scan is running it will end mechanically when you begin by means of your computer and recommence another time at a later time when your machine is once again inactive or IDLE. several other users have renowned troubles with IDLE complete scans ongoing to run when a CPU intensive application is being run at the similar time except once you in fact use your computer the IDLE complete scan will mechanically end. Idle rapid scans which are run when fresh definitions are downloaded cannot be blocked but these should is not at all be a trouble since they typically take fewer than 1 minute to run.
